The Rocking Horse
Dear Rocking Horse
My faithful steed
We once ruled these halls
Roaming wild and free
We fought vigorous wars
We rode around the world
All the things we’ve done before
Were never too big for this horse and this girl
But as the years went by
Our relationship had changed
I was no longer interested in fairytales
I was too concerned about painting my nails
And now as I look back at you
I remember our times together
The wind in my hair
Riding away without a care
But now your black paint is peeled and cracked
Your legs are wore down and flat
So I’m saying goodbye and letting you go
To Rocking Horse Heaven where you can run free
